#be0406 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#be0406 is composed of 74.5% red, 1.6%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97.9% magenta, 96.8%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 359.4 degrees, a saturation of 95.9% and a lightness of 38%. #be0406 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ff080c with #7d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0000.

#be0406 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#be0406 has RGB values of R:190, G:4, B:6 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.98, Y:0.97,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12452870.

Hex triplet be0406 #be0406
RGB Decimal 190, 4, 6 rgb(190,4,6)
RGB Percent 74.5, 1.6, 2.4 rgb(74.5%,1.6%,2.4%)
CMYK 0, 98, 97, 25
HSL 359.4°, 95.9, 38 hsl(359.4,95.9%,38%)
HSV (or HSB) 359.4°, 97.9, 74.5
Web Safe cc0000 #cc0000
CIE-LAB 39.665, 63.831, 51.676
XYZ 21.313, 11.05, 1.183
xyY 0.635, 0.329, 11.05
CIE-LCH 39.665, 82.127, 38.993
CIE-LUV 39.665, 128.605, 27.538
Hunter-Lab 33.242, 56.272, 21.159
Binary 10111110, 00000100, 00000110

Shades and Tints of #be0406

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110001 is the darkest color, while #fffd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#be0406

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#645e5e is the less saturated color, while #be0406 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#be0406 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#3c3c3c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#563131 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#716622 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#7f6100 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#c01400 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#8d4218 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#963f02 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#bf0e02 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
